However the construction that you mentioned are known to be renown as a weaker, softer build as they are glassed epoxy.
Surftech is a whole different technology and is heavier then the epoxy boards pictured in your post.
Personally I don't mind the heavier more durable surftech Lairds. Have a good look over the board and see whether it has any soft spots of water stains on the bamboo deck.
I would hold off any look for a tufflite construction Laird.
However,If it is well looked after grab it as they are pretty rare.
